Build a power that progressively drains stun over an area effect from the character’s enemies. At the same time it progressively adds those points to his allies. None of the points can be used by the character and the power has an active point limit of 75.

You're definitely looking at two powers here. But the problem is, an AE Selective Drain is fairly expensive. You're looking at a (+1.25) advantage on a power that's already 15 points per die.

 

You could alternatively buy it as a Drain, AE Selective, and link an END reserve to it. Then run an AE Selective Succor off the end reserve, triggered by the Drain (looking at a +1.5 advantage now), limited Only Up To Active Points Drained (-1/2). Now you're chewing up not a ton of your own endurance, and you're having a noticeable effect on the battle.

Adding to STUN runs up against limits quickly and drains away, so sidestep the problem:

 

Area of effect selective transfer STUN to RECOVERY, useable by others but not by self (you'd have to specify how many of your chums get to use it and pay for the advantge accordingly)

 

Don't have to book to look up exact values but, so it may be out but:

 

TRANSFER 15 AP for 1d6 (STUN TO REC) + 16 added to pool (+8 AP) to total 22 points to transfer.

 

Advantages

Selective AE radius (+1.25)

UBO (+1 for 4 other people to use it)

 

Real cost: 75, active points 75

 

Howzat?

 

(or you can do it STUN to STUN, but that will fade and limits how much stun you can add)
